About The Position

The Licensed Clinical Social Worker III position at Sutter Health involves providing biopsychosocial assessments, crisis intervention, short-term counseling, and linkage with resources for patients and their families across various care settings. The role includes psycho-education, facilitating support groups, and consulting on psychosocial aspects of care as part of an interdisciplinary treatment team. The social worker will also assist with discharge planning and provide support to patients in adjusting to illness, facilitating goals of care conversations. Additionally, the position may involve educating staff and participating in committees.
